The Renewable Drones Market has emerged as a vital player in the renewable energy sector, offering innovative solutions for the inspection, maintenance, and optimization of renewable energy assets such as wind turbines and solar panels. Drones, equipped with advanced sensors and imaging technology, enable more efficient and cost-effective operations, contributing to the growth and sustainability of the renewable energy industry.

Key Drivers:

Efficient Inspection and Maintenance: Renewable energy installations, particularly wind turbines, require regular inspections to ensure their optimal performance and longevity. Drones equipped with high-resolution cameras and sensors can conduct comprehensive inspections without the need for costly and time-consuming manual checks.

Enhanced Safety: Using drones for inspections and maintenance reduces the risks associated with human workers climbing turbines or navigating solar farms. This enhanced safety not only protects workers but also minimizes downtime due to accidents or injuries.

Data-Driven Decision-Making: Renewable drones collect vast amounts of data during inspections. Advanced analytics and artificial intelligence processes this data to identify issues, predict maintenance needs, and optimize energy production, ultimately improving asset performance.

Environmental Impact: The renewable drones market aligns with the sustainability goals of the renewable energy industry. By minimizing the need for on-site visits, drones reduce the carbon footprint associated with transportation and machinery operation.

Market Segmentation:

The Renewable Drones Market can be segmented based on drone type, application, end-user, and region. Drone types include fixed-wing, rotary-wing (quadcopters and hexacopters), and hybrid drones, each suited to specific applications. Common applications encompass wind turbine inspections, solar panel assessments, LiDAR surveys, and environmental monitoring. Key end-users include renewable energy companies, drone service providers, and environmental agencies.

Challenges:

Despite its growth, the Renewable Drones Market faces challenges. Ensuring regulatory compliance and safety standards for drone operations is a priority. Additionally, addressing cybersecurity concerns and developing standardized data management practices are essential for sustained growth.
